Product Introduction
The Honeywell 900RTC-L050 Remote Terminal Low Voltage Cable Assembly is a dedicated connectivity solution designed to provide reliable low-voltage transmission between remote terminal units (RTUs), I/O modules, and controllers within Honeywell’s automation systems. Specifically engineered for Honeywell’s HC900 Hybrid Control System, the cable ensures high-performance signal integrity, stable operation, and compatibility with industrial automation requirements.
This assembly plays a crucial role in distributed control environments, enabling secure communication between field devices and centralized controllers. With durable insulation, shielding against electromagnetic interference, and factory-terminated connectors, the 900RTC-L050 reduces installation time while enhancing system reliability.
Product Specifications
| Parameter | Description |
|---|---|
| Model | Honeywell 900RTC-L050 |
| Product Type | Remote Terminal Low Voltage Cable Assembly |
| Cable Length | 5 meters |
| Voltage Rating | Low voltage (≤ 30 VDC) |
| Current Capacity | Up to 2 A per conductor |
| Connector Type | Factory-terminated connectors compatible with HC900 RTU modules |
| Conductor Material | Stranded, tinned copper for high flexibility and conductivity |
| Insulation | Industrial-grade PVC or equivalent with high dielectric strength |
| Shielding | Foil shield with drain wire for EMI/RFI reduction |
| Temperature Rating | -20 °C to +80 °C |
| Flame Retardancy | UL VW-1 compliant |
| Environmental Compliance | CE, UL, RoHS-certified materials |
| Weight | 0.68 kg |

FAQ
-
What conductor type is used in the 900RTC-L050?
It uses stranded, tinned copper conductors for enhanced flexibility and conductivity. -
Is the cable shielded to prevent interference?
Yes, it is shielded with foil and includes a drain wire to minimize EMI and RFI. -
What is the voltage capacity of this cable assembly?
It is designed for low-voltage applications up to 30 VDC. -
Does the cable support Honeywell HC900 RTU modules directly?
Yes, the cable is factory-terminated and fully compatible with HC900 RTU interfaces. -
What is the maximum current per conductor?
Each conductor can handle up to 2 A under normal operating conditions. -
Can the cable withstand high industrial temperatures?
Yes, it operates reliably in environments from -20 °C to +80 °C. -
Is the cable suitable for use in noisy electrical environments?
Yes, its shielding significantly improves noise immunity and signal reliability. -
Does it comply with international standards?
Yes, it meets CE, UL, and RoHS standards. -
Can it be extended with additional cables?
While possible, Honeywell recommends direct connections to preserve signal integrity. -
What advantage does factory termination provide?
It guarantees proper contact alignment, prevents wiring errors, and ensures consistent performance.
